At its core, blockchain technology is a chain of blocks, each containing a set of transactions. These blocks are cryptographically linked together, forming an unalterable record. This distributed nature means that no single entity has control, making it incredibly resistant to fraud and manipulation. When we talk about "blockchain money," we're referring to digital currencies, like Bitcoin and Ethereum, that are built on this technology. But the revolution doesn't stop at cryptocurrencies. The underlying principles of blockchain are giving rise to Decentralized Finance, or DeFi.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– on open, decentralized blockchain networks. This means no intermediaries, lower fees, and greater accessibility.

Understanding the foundational elements of blockchain money is your first crucial step. Cryptocurrencies, while the most visible manifestation, are just one piece of the puzzle. Each cryptocurrency has its own unique features, use cases, and underlying technology. Bitcoin, the first and most well-known, was designed as a peer-to-peer electronic cash system. Ethereum, on the other hand, introduced smart contracts – self-executing contracts with the terms of the agreement directly written into code. These smart contracts are the building blocks for a vast array of decentralized applications (dApps), powering everything from decentralized exchanges (DEXs) to non-fungible tokens (NFTs).

The concept of stablecoins is also crucial to the blockchain money ecosystem. These are cryptocurrencies designed to minimize volatility, typically by being pegged to a fiat currency like the US dollar. Stablecoins act as a bridge between the volatile world of cryptocurrencies and traditional finance, offering a reliable medium of exchange and a store of value within the blockchain space. They are essential for many DeFi applications, providing a stable base for trading, lending, and borrowing.
